| | The King James Version Online Bible (KJV) | The American Standard Version Online Bible (ASV) |
| 3rd-John 1:1 | The elder unto the wellbeloved Gaius, whom I love in the truth. | The elder unto Gaius the beloved, whom I love in truth. |
| 3rd-John 1:2 | Beloved, I wish above all things that thou mayest prosper and be in health, even as thy soul prospereth. | Beloved, I pray that in all things thou mayest prosper and be in health, even as thy soul prospereth. |
| 3rd-John 1:3 | For I rejoiced greatly, when the brethren came and testified of the truth that is in thee, even as thou walkest in the truth. | For I rejoiced greatly, when brethren came and bare witness unto thy truth, even as thou walkest in truth. |
| 3rd-John 1:4 | I have no greater joy than to hear that my children walk in truth. | Greater joy have I none than this, to hear of my children walking in the truth. |
| 3rd-John 1:5 | Beloved, thou doest faithfully whatsoever thou doest to the brethren, and to strangers; | Beloved, thou doest a faithful work in whatsoever thou doest toward them that are brethren and strangers withal; |
| 3rd-John 1:6 | Which have borne witness of thy charity before the church: whom if thou bring forward on their journey after a godly sort, thou shalt do well: | who bare witness to thy love before the church: whom thou wilt do well to set forward on their journey worthily of God: |
| 3rd-John 1:7 | Because that for his name's sake they went forth, taking nothing of the Gentiles. | because that for the sake of the Name they went forth, taking nothing of the Gentiles. |
| 3rd-John 1:8 | We therefore ought to receive such, that we might be fellowhelpers to the truth. | We therefore ought to welcome such, that we may be fellow-workers for the truth. |
| 3rd-John 1:9 | I wrote unto the church: but Diotrephes, who loveth to have the preeminence among them, receiveth us not. | I wrote somewhat unto the church: but Diotrephes, who loveth to have the preeminence among them, receiveth us not. |
| 3rd-John 1:10 | Wherefore, if I come, I will remember his deeds which he doeth, prating against us with malicious words: and not content therewith, neither doth he himself receive the brethren, and forbiddeth them that would, and casteth them out of the church. | Therefore, if I come, I will bring to remembrance his works which he doeth, prating against us with wicked words: and not content therewith, neither doth he himself receive the brethren, and them that would he forbiddeth and casteth [them] out of the church. |
| 3rd-John 1:11 | Beloved, follow not that which is evil, but that which is good. He that doeth good is of God: but he that doeth evil hath not seen God. | Beloved, imitate not that which is evil, but that which is good. He that doeth good is of God: he that doeth evil hath not seen God. |
| 3rd-John 1:12 | Demetrius hath good report of all men, and of the truth itself: yea, and we also bear record; and ye know that our record is true. | Demetrius hath the witness of all [men], and of the truth itself: yea, we also bear witness: and thou knowest that our witness is true. |
| 3rd-John 1:13 | I had many things to write, but I will not with ink and pen write unto thee: | I had many things to write unto thee, but I am unwilling to write [them] to thee with ink and pen: |
| 3rd-John 1:14 | But I trust I shall shortly see thee, and we shall speak face to face. Peace be to thee. Our friends salute thee. Greet the friends by name. | but I hope shortly to see thee, and we shall speak face to face. Peace [be] unto thee. The friends salute thee. Salute the friends by name. |
